Metropolitan Museum of Art: Modern art

The Met's modern art collection, housed on the second-floor Lila Acheson Wallace Wing, is a fascinating and relatively compact group of paintings. Picasso's Portrait of Gertrude Stein and his blue-period The Blind Man's Meal are here, alongside works by Klee, Modigliani, Braque and Klimt . Other highlights include Hopper 's Views From Williamsburg Bridge and O'Keefe 's, sumptuous, erotic Black Iris , Pollock 's masterly Autumn Rhythm (Number 30) and Warhol 's Last Self-Portrait , which dates from 1986.
